2 votes

Comment charger des fichiers de configuration personnalisés avec codeigniter?

Je viens de commencer à utiliser codeigniter et j'ai une question.

Je suis en train d'utiliser des tableaux pour définir certaines valeurs comme:

$gender = array ('homme','femme'); 

Ou:

$maritalStatus = array ('marié', 'célibataire', 'divorcé');

J'utilise ce genre de tableaux dans différentes vues. Ma question est, est-il possible de mettre tous ces tableaux dans un fichier de configuration et de le charger quand j'en ai besoin ? Ou existe-t-il une autre méthode pour y parvenir ?

Un grand merci.

7voto

BoltClock Points 249668

Oui, vous le pouvez. Il suffit de placer toutes vos variables dans un tableau, et enregistrer ce tableau dans un fichier de configuration séparé dans system/application/config.

Ensuite, dans votre code d'application, chargez le fichier de configuration comme suit :

$this->config->load($config_file);

$config_file est le nom de votre fichier de configuration, sans l'extension .php.

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X